395 Zimbabweans Return From Botswana As COVID-19 Repatriation Continues

The government of Zimbabwe has announced that 395 Zimbabweans returned from Botswana today as part of Coronavirus repatriation. According to the Ministry of Information Publicity and Broadcasting Secretary, Nick Mangwana, the number includes 15 ex-convicts who were pardoned by the Botswana government.

Said Mangwana:

395 Zimbabweans left Gaborone today for Plumtree. Among the returnees are 15 ex-convicts who were pardoned by President Masisi. Some are coming voluntarily and others have visa challenges.Govt will use the Criminal Justice System to visit those who are in need of its attention.

The Zimbabwean government has been working with other governments in the region as well as private transport operators to facilitate the return of Zimbabweans willing to come home.

South Africa and Botswana have the highest number of Zimbabweans living abroad in the region.
